|
COLLAPSE = "collapse"
|
||||||
|
EXPAND = "expand"
|
||||||
|
|
||||||
|
|
||||||
|
@dataclass
|
||||||
|
class Node:
|
||||||
|
value: Any
|
||||||
|
|
||||||
|
|
||||||
|
@dataclass
|
||||||
|
class ValueNode(Node):
|
||||||
|
hint: str = None
|
||||||
|
|
||||||
|
|
||||||
|
@dataclass
|
||||||
|
class ListNode(Node):
|
||||||
|
node_id: str
|
||||||
|
level: int
|
||||||
|
children: list[Node] = field(default_factory=list)
|
||||||
|
|
||||||
|
|
||||||
|
@dataclass
|
||||||
|
class DictNode(Node):
|
||||||
|
node_id: str
|
||||||
|
level: int
|
||||||
|
children: dict[str, Node] = field(default_factory=dict)
|
||||||
|
|
||||||
|
|
||||||
|
class NodeIdGenerator:
|
||||||
|
"""Manages unique node ID generation"""
|
||||||
|
|
||||||
|
def __init__(self, base_id: str):
|
||||||
|
self.base_id = base_id
|
||||||
|
self._counter = -1
|
||||||
|
|

# README - End-to-End Authentication Testing Guide
|
||||||
|
|
||||||
|
This README provides details on how to set up, configure, and run the end-to-end (e2e) authentication tests for the **My
|
||||||
|
Managing Tools** application. The tests are implemented using `pytest` with `playwright` for browser automation.
|
||||||
|
|
||||||
|
## Purpose
|
||||||
|
|
||||||
|
The e2e tests verify that the authentication system works as expected, including login functionality, session
|
||||||
|
validation, and database isolation for testing purposes. These tests ensure the login page behaves properly under
|
||||||
|
different scenarios such as unauthenticated access, form validation, and successful user login.
